Montrose Area - Montrose lies in the fertile Uncompahgre River Valley. This area was once used by Ute Indians for farming and hunting. Today it serves the many ranchers and recreationists that use the surrounding terrain.
Ouray Area - This small town known as the 'Little Switzerland of America,' was named for the Southern Ute Chief, who tried to negotiate with the U.S. Government as it pushed his tribe on to a reservation.
Telluride Area - The small ski town (population 1,400) of Telluride began as a supply town for area silver mines during the 1870s. It's bloomed into a destination resort with world class recreation opportunities.
